The Medical Director/Physician will lead and oversee the clinic's clinical care operations, guiding a small but expanding team of Nurse Practitioners, and directly providing primary care to patients. Partnering closely with the Health Administrator and Tribal leadership and operations team to ensure quality, culturally sensitive, and compliant care while preparing the clinic for strategic service expansion.

Duties:
ESSENTIAL DUTIES AND RESPONSIBILITIES• Must have the following active licenses: Current or ability to obtain and maintain an unrestricted Michigan Medical License.• Must have Community Staff privileges at Munson Medical Center.• Provide direct primary care (at least 50%-60% clinical time) including diagnosis, treatment, preventive care, chronic disease management, lab/radiology interpretation, and referrals. Supervise and mentor 2-4 Nurse Practitioners, offering clinical guidance, chart review, case consultation, peer review, and professional feedback, via a collaborative agreement in conformance with the Grand Traverse Band's policies and procedures as established by the Grand Traverse Band and federal, state and local laws and regulations. Act as preceptor for new NPs or PAs; oversee onboarding, including clinical supervision and performance evaluation.• Design, implement, and monitor clinical quality improvement activities, including periodic peer review, chart audits, and QA/CQI programs as per tribal and accreditation standards• Maintain and update clinical policies, procedures, and protocols aligned with tribal governance and state/federal regulations (e.g. Medicare/Medicaid, rural health clinic, AAAHC, or IHS standards)• Participate in strategic planning, program expansion, and grant development or reporting. Support the development of new clinical services or sites.• Staffing & Recruitment: Assist in recruiting, onboarding, and credentialing of new clinical staff (NPs, nurses, lab, etc.), including interviews and provider selection; Manage provider scheduling, supervision, performance appraisals, leave approvals, and performance improvement plans as needed.• Compliance & External Relations: Work with the Health Administrator to develop and ensure compliance with tribal, state, federal (including Indian Health Service or CMS) and accreditation requirements. Take lead in accreditation preparation processes (e.g. AAAHC or JCAHO).• Act as clinic liaison with external partners (local hospitals, health departments, IHS, tribal council, and grant agencies). Attend meetings and represent the medical department.• Provides comprehensive clinical care (educative, curative, preventive, and rehabilitative) at a primary care level.• Using a multi-disciplinary team approach, implementing processes and provide overall direction to ensure maximum use of available GTB services (educative, curative, preventive, rehabilitative, etc.) and cost effective util Qualifications:
MINIMUM QUALIFICATIONS• Must have an active State of Michigan Physician License, State of Michigan Controlled Substance License, and Federal DEA License, with Board Certification in Family Practice.• Must have Community Staff Privileges at Munson Medical Center or obtain within a reasonable time.• Must have a valid Michigan Driver's License and be insurable by the GTB insurance carrier.
